Google DeepMind Staff Gain Access to Claude, Sparking Internal Dispute Over Unequal AI Tools

1 reports · First detected 2026-04-22 · Last active 2026-04-22

Google DeepMind is Google's core AI research organization and develops models including Gemini. Some of its teams are allowed to use rival Anthropic's Claude for coding, while most Google engineers still primarily use Gemini. The disparity has sparked an internal dispute over access to tools, development efficiency and the competitiveness of Google's own models.

As of July 20, 2026, reports said only some Google DeepMind employees had been authorized to use Claude. The exact number of employees, the date access was granted and any amounts involved had not been disclosed. Most employees remained restricted to Google's Gemini. The dispute centers on differences between the two models' coding performance and the company's inconsistent AI tool policies across teams.
